Как выборочно убрать кеширование на станице.

Автор Тема: Как выборочно убрать кеширование на станице.  (Прочитано 1217 раз)

Оффлайн KrapАвтор темы

  • Бизнес оценка: (0)
  • Старожил
  • ****
  • СПАСИБО: 57
  • Сообщений: 307
  • Карма: 11

Оффлайн KrapАвтор темы

  • Старожил
  • ****
Есть главная страница, она постоянно обновляется.  Часть информации я иногда прямо в HTML добавляю - пару картинок с ссылками на них. Вот пример:
Код:
Только зарегистрированные пользователи могут видеть код. Пожалуйста, войдите или зарегистрируйтесь.После  добавления картинок на главную картинку, они всё равно не появляются, нужно сделать принудительную очистку кеша. Простые пользователи явно этого делать не будут. Есть так-же слайдер там такая-же история, ссылки и текст меняется а картинки старые. Как сделать что-бы эта часть кода не кешировалась? Может какие теги есть или ещё чего.


Оффлайн ezhabchik

  • Бизнес оценка: (1, 100%)
  • Постоялец
  • ***
  • СПАСИБО: 36
  • Сообщений: 199
  • Карма: 5

Оффлайн ezhabchik

  • Постоялец
  • ***
Что-бы не кэшировалась только " эта часть кода" так скорей всего не получится, а вот запретить кэшировать всю страницу - это без проблем:

<meta http-equiv="Cache-Control" content="private">

Оффлайн KrapАвтор темы

  • Бизнес оценка: (0)
  • Старожил
  • ****
  • СПАСИБО: 57
  • Сообщений: 307
  • Карма: 11

Оффлайн KrapАвтор темы

  • Старожил
  • ****
Решил проблему, просто меняя название картинки)

Оффлайн ezhabchik

  • Бизнес оценка: (1, 100%)
  • Постоялец
  • ***
  • СПАСИБО: 36
  • Сообщений: 199
  • Карма: 5

Оффлайн ezhabchik

  • Постоялец
  • ***
А как изменение названия картинки решило проблему с кешированием?  :o

Оффлайн KrapАвтор темы

  • Бизнес оценка: (0)
  • Старожил
  • ****
  • СПАСИБО: 57
  • Сообщений: 307
  • Карма: 11

Оффлайн KrapАвтор темы

  • Старожил
  • ****
Я не прогоамист, но понимаю, что если в html указать путь к новой картинке, а страрый удалить, то эта новая инфа должна появится на сайте.


Оффлайн ezhabchik

  • Бизнес оценка: (1, 100%)
  • Постоялец
  • ***
  • СПАСИБО: 36
  • Сообщений: 199
  • Карма: 5

Оффлайн ezhabchik

  • Постоялец
  • ***
На сайте да, но в кэше браузера-то может остаться  :)
У меня были случаи, когда в коде что-то поменял, а в браузере все так и оставалось, пока кэш не почищу


 

Похожие темы

  Тема / Автор Ответов Последний ответ
6 Ответов
3635 Просмотров
Последний ответ 20-05-2011, 20:01:05
от Богдан
7 Ответов
2571 Просмотров
Последний ответ 23-06-2013, 14:00:46
от jmotner
1 Ответов
2871 Просмотров
Последний ответ 19-02-2014, 08:35:26
от Владимир75
0 Ответов
987 Просмотров
Последний ответ 16-03-2014, 13:32:30
от pombur
6 Ответов
1845 Просмотров
Последний ответ 27-10-2014, 20:07:36
от Sham